Step-by-step explanation:
The diagonals meet at right angles. Interesting property.
The hypotenuse is the side of the rhombus = 15 cm
One of the sides of the small triangles created by the intersection of the diagonals = 24/2 = 12
You can find the other side of the the triangle by using the Pythagorean Theorem
a^2 + b^2 = c^2
c = 15
a = 12
b = ?
12^2 + b^2 = 15^2
144 + b^2 = 225
b^2 = 225 - 144
b^2 = 81
b = 9
The area of this right angle = 9 * 12/2 = 54
There are 4 of them so 4 * 54 = 216
That's the area of the rhombus.
The h= Area / b
b = 15
h = 216/15
h = 14.4

Answer:
1571 in
Step-by-step explanation:
Given data
Diamter= 25 in
radius= 25/2= 12.5in
Circumference= 2πr
substitute
C=2*3.142*12.5
C=78.55in
In 1 revolution the bike will travel 78.55in
in 20 revolutions the bike will travel
=78.55*20
=1571 in
